Pros

I was a receptionist for the 2014 tax season. Great seasonal position. Overall it was easy going, but I had a horrible manager so I basically trained myself. My coworkers were mostly retired. All wonderful and supportive individuals who did their best to help me since I was new. We all had a fun time working and helping clients, especially when our manager wasn't there to dictate out every move and steal all the new clients for herself.

Cons

I would have given my experience 5 stars, but my office manager ruined it for me. She was the worst "boss" I have ever had. Unreasonable, hypocritical, abrasive, and the list goes on. I eventually confronted her and she acted innocent, kid of blowing it off. I sucked it up until the end of the season and just did my best.
